Output d95bc81e5400bcbe091f851cf10c7db21fe25ea766c0898f5bb5947a61eac087:38

value
71136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39ba314798fc05ee8633dd68f95e17576b780155 OP_EQUAL
address
36xFVMpHGurq4YFt4FfFbBYZkprNUUNUQ2
transaction
d95bc81e5400bcbe091f851cf10c7db21fe25ea766c0898f5bb5947a61eac087